Honda prices Insight at $20,470
Advertisements [?]
That price includes shipping. The Insight is scheduled to go on sale March 24, said Dick Colliver, American Honda's executive vice president of sales.

The Insight's main competitor, the Toyota Prius, sells for a base list price of $22,720, including shipping.

Despite a weak economy, Honda aims to sell 90,000 units of the Insight in the United States in its first 12 months, said company spokesman Chris Martin.

The Insight has an EPA fuel efficiency rating of 40 mpg city/43 highway.

The Insight is the sole hybrid-only Honda vehicle. Honda sells hybrid and gasoline-powered versions of the Civic compact.

From 1999 to 2006, Honda produced a three-door hybrid called the Insight.

Honda dealers say they are excited about the new Insight.

"I think we will see pressure returning to get better miles per gallon and lower greenhouse emissions," said Peter Hoffman, president of Sierra Motor Co. in suburban Los Angeles. "The car is a great answer for those concerns, and I'm looking forward to seeing one."

Said Eric Kahn, owner of Friendly Honda in Poughkeepsie, N.Y.: "The key for the Insight is the pricing. There should be a price difference between the Insight and the competition."

Last year, Toyota sold 158,884 units of the Prius in the United States, down 12.3percent from 2007.

William Walton, manager of automobile product planning at American Honda, said the Insight's target buyers are single young professionals in their 20s.
